About Xiao Wu

Xiao Wu is a scholar working on Media Technology, Acoustics and Ultrasonics and Electronic, Optical and Magnetic Materials, having authored 42 papers that have together received 676 indexed citations. Recurring topics across this work include Advanced Image Fusion Techniques (11 papers), Remote-Sensing Image Classification (7 papers) and Magnetic and transport properties of perovskites and related materials (6 papers). The work is most often cited by research in Media Technology (290 citations), Atmospheric Science (211 citations) and Computer Vision and Pattern Recognition (208 citations). Xiao Wu has collaborated with scholars based in China, United States and Italy. Frequent co-authors include Liang-Jian Deng, Ran Ran, Gemine Vivone, Danfeng Hong, Ting‐Zhu Huang, Na Xu, Xi Wang, Zhaojun Zheng, Guangzhen Cao and Chuan Li. Their work appears in journals such as Physical Review Letters, Journal of Applied Physics and IEEE Transactions on Pattern Analysis and Machine Intelligence.
